Therapy vs. Coaching: Understanding the Difference is Important!!

Therapy is a clinical service (often insurance funded) aimed at diagnosing and treating mental health conditions, addressing emotional struggles, and navigating psychological challenges. It often delves into past experiences, trauma, and patterns that influence your current well-being. Licensed therapists are trained professionals dedicated to facilitating healing, offering insight, and enhancing mental and emotional health. Licensed therapists often use similar approaches as coaches at times and more.

Coaching is a non-clinical (patient funded), future-oriented service designed to bolster personal growth, goal-setting, and behavior change. Unlike therapy, coaching does not diagnose or treat mental illness. Instead, it empowers individuals to clarify their current position, articulate their aspirations, and strategize actionable steps for progress. The coaching process is inherently collaborative, emphasizing action and rooted in the individual's strengths, values, and intrinsic potential. Coaches do not provide answers but explore them with clients.

In a nutshell: Therapy provides the tools for healing, whereas coaching equips you to flourish and evolve.
